SyncEvolution synchronizes Evolution's contact, calendar and task items via SyncML. The items are exchanged in the vCard 2.1 or 3.0 format and iCalendar 2.0 format via the Synthesis C++ client API library, which should make SyncEvolution compatible with the majority of SyncML servers. Full, one-way and incremental synchronization of items are supported.
